A captivating and wonderfully illustrated chronicle of one of the most influential and legendary names in gunsmithing history.
John M. Browning was born in Ogden, Utah, in 1855, into a world of gunsmithing. His father was a gunsmith who was already well known, for a number of innovations in the field. As a young boy, John spent hours in his father's shop and allegedly knew the name of every part of a gun before he could read. It's hardly surprising...

Annie Oakley was a real woman who became a legend through her extraordinary life and skills. She was a crack shot with a rifle and became a star attraction of Buffalo Bills Wild West Show. She also became a symbol of Americans indomitable spirit and the thirst for adventure and opportunity that drove people to expand westward into unknown territory.
